Swagger spec is not normalized if structure is hidden behind a reference
I tracked down a regression in swagger-ui to an interaction between swagger normalization and subtree resolution introduced in https://github.com/swagger-api/swagger-js/pull/1274.
With that change, normalization happens only before subtree resolution, and this breaks in cases where the structure of the references hides the structure of the swagger file from normalization.
I boiled it down to this this test https://github.com/swagger-api/swagger-js/compare/master...biochimia:regression/normalize-before-resolution

Describe the bug you're encountering
Because normalizeSwagger() doesn't get to see the structure of the path object before resolution, if doesn't copy path parameters into individual methods. Later when the subtrees are resolved normalization is already disabled and is not performed.
